Patent number: 9308404Abstract: A device for suppressing and/or extinguishing a fire associated with a container may include a housing defining a hollow sleeve and a column configured to be received within the hollow sleeve. The column may define a first chamber, a second chamber, at least one aperture, and a piercing end configured to pierce a barrier. The first chamber may be configured to receive an expansion agent, and the second chamber may be configured to receive a fire extinguishing agent. The device may be configured such that upon activation of the expansion agent, the column extends from the housing so as to enable the piercing end to penetrate the container and to enable the fire extinguishing agent to be delivered into an interior of the container via the at least one aperture.Type: GrantFiled: March 21, 2007Date of Patent: April 12, 2016Assignee: FEDERAL EXPRESS CORPORATIONInventor: James B. Popp

Publication number: 20150258358Abstract: A device for supplying fire suppressing agent to the interior of a container for an extended duration may include a plurality of chambers configured to contain and selectively expel the fire suppressing agent, a puncture mechanism configured to puncture a container, and a manifold in flow communication with the plurality of chambers and the puncture mechanism. The device may further include a controller configured to initiate expulsion of the fire suppressing agent from the chambers in a controlled manner, where the device is configured such that the fire suppressing agent may be first expelled from a first one of the plurality of chambers at a first time, and the fire suppressing agent may be expelled from a second one of the plurality of chambers at a second time that is later than the first time.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 12, 2015Publication date: September 17, 2015Applicant: FEDERAL EXPRESS CORPORATIONInventors: James B. POPP, Joseph MAY

Patent number: 9126744Abstract: A container for containing and/or suppressing a fire may include a floor, a roof, and at least one wall associating the floor and the roof. The at least one wall may define an opening configured to provide access to the interior of the container. The container may further include at least one panel configured to close the opening. At least one of the floor, the roof, the at least one wall, and the at least one panel may include an intumescent material substantially covering an interior surface thereof.Type: GrantFiled: March 23, 2006Date of Patent: September 8, 2015Assignee: FEDERAL EXPRESS CORPORATIONInventors: Jeffrey E. Peltz, Arthur J. Benjamin

Patent number: 9095001Abstract: A method of management of a wireless device in an aircraft may include transitioning the wireless device from a first mode to a second mode based on data that is indicative of a change in flight condition of the aircraft. One of these modes may be a state of the device in which a transmitter of the device is deactivated and the other mode may be a state of the device in which the transmitter is activated. The data indicative of the change in flight condition may either be downloaded to the device from an external source, acquired from a sensor(s) embedded in the device, or may be determined based on both the data acquired by the sensor(s) and data downloaded to the device.Type: GrantFiled: April 16, 2010Date of Patent: July 28, 2015Assignee: FEDERAL EXPRESS CORPORATIONInventors: Andrew N. Lemmon, Ole-Petter Skaaksrud, J. Randy Jacobs

Publication number: 20150151838Abstract: A system for enhancing vision inside an aircraft cockpit may include a primary display system configured to receive the signals related to flight data and display visual representations based on the flight data. The system for enhancing vision may also include a supplemental display system, including a mask configured to provide a substantially sealed barrier between a wearer of the mask and at least one of smoke and fumes in the cockpit. The supplemental display system may also include a video display device associated with the mask. The video display device may be configured to receive the signals related to the flight data and display the visual representations based on the flight data, wherein the video display device is associated with the mask such that the wearer of the mask is able to see the visual representations based on the flight data displayed by the video display device.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 2, 2014Publication date: June 4, 2015Applicant: FEDERAL EXPRESS CORPORATIONInventors: JOHN S. KERNS, JAMES B. POPP, ROBERT A. KEETON

Patent number: 8905633Abstract: A combination fire detection and fire suppression system may include a fire detection system configured to detect an undesirably high temperature associated with an area. The fire detection system may include a temperature sensor including a temperature sensor array and a fire alerting system associated with the temperature sensor. The fire alerting system may be configured to receive information from the temperature sensor and generate a warning signal based on an undesirably high temperature associated with the area. The fire detection system may include a fire control panel configured to receive the warning signal. The system may also include a fire suppression system including a fire suppressant delivery system configured to provide at least one fire suppressant agent to the area associated with the undesirably high temperature.Type: GrantFiled: August 27, 2009Date of Patent: December 9, 2014Assignee: Federal Express CorporationInventors: James B. Popp, Arthur J. Benjamin

Patent number: 8459538Abstract: An opening system for a container includes an end flap for extending over an opening of the container, and a sealing flap overlying the end flap. The end flap includes an open area and the sealing flap includes a perforation pattern. The perforation pattern includes a first perforation line including a central section extending over the open area, and a second perforation line extending from the first perforation line to one edge of the sealing flap. The first perforation line is configured to tear at a lower force than the second perforation line.Type: GrantFiled: December 10, 2009Date of Patent: June 11, 2013Assignee: Federal Express CorporationInventors: Erika J. Raeth, Kenneth Vilag, Thomas J. Wood
